New Zealand international offered to Super League clubs as more NRL options emerge

Super League clubs have been offered New Zealand international Ken Maumalo, Rugby League Live can reveal. The Kiwi international, 29, has emerged as an option for clubs after his representatives put out the feelers earlier this week.


Maumalo is an outside back who has played internationally for both Samoa and New Zealand, making two of his appearances for the Kiwis in their victories over Great Britain in 2019. His NRL career started in 2015, making his debut for the Warriors and he remained there for seven seasons before joining Wests Tigers in 2021. He was granted a release from the club earlier this year and signed for Gold Coast Titans, though he has yet to make an appearance this season. In total, Maumalo has made 135 NRL appearances, scoring 63 tries.
